Biomass and biofuels made from biomass are alternative energy sources to fossil fuels—coal, … Web6 sep. 2024 · This Web page focuses primarily on woody biomass. Biomass contains stored energy. Plants absorb energy from the sun and convert this solar energy into chemical energy during the process of photosynthesis. This energy is released as heat when the plants or other organic materials are burned. Biomass is considered a …

Most electricity generated from biomass is produced by direct … east peoria father\u0027s day baseball tournamentWeb16 mrt. 2024 · Converting biomass to energy. Biomass is converted to energy through various processes, including: Direct combustion (burning) to produce heat. Thermochemical conversion to produce solid, gaseous, and liquid fuels.
